如何获取默认MySQL数据库中的表列表?

众所周知,默认的MySQL数据库将是当前用于后续查询的数据库。我们可以使用SHOWTABLES语句获取该数据库中的表列表。mysql>SHOWTABLES;+------------------+|Tables_in_sample|+------------------+|em...

如何查看现有 MySQL 表的 CREATE TABLE 语句?

我们可以使用SHOWCREATETABLE查询来查看现有表的建表语句。...

使用 MySQL 查找并替换整个表中的文本?

可以在replace()函数的帮助下找到并替换文本。它的解释是在以下步骤的帮助下-首先,在create命令的帮助下创建一个表,如下所示-mysql>CREATEtableFindAndReplaceDemo->(->FirstNamevarchar(200)->);Quer...

什么是 MySQL 存储函数以及如何创建它们?

Thisfeatureofstoredfunctionsisdifferentfromstoredprocedures.Actually,astoredfunctionparameterisequivalentoftheINparameterofthestoredprocedureasthefunctionsuseRETURNkeywor...

如何在WHERE子句中使用MySQL日期函数?

...

MySQL 中 CHAR 和 VARCHAR 有什么区别?

...

我们如何启用和禁用特定的MySQL事件?

示例mysql>ALTEREVENThelloDISABLE;QueryOK,0rowsaffected(0.00sec)上述查询将禁用名为‘Hello’的事件,下面的查询将启用它。mysql>ALTEREVENThelloENABLE;QueryOK,0rowsaffected(0.0...

"MySQL与标准SQL的区别"

以上就是"MySQL与标准SQL的区别"的详细内容,更多请关注其它相关文章!...

用户如何开始新的 MySQL 事务?

...

当我们使用 ALTER TABLE 语句对包含 NULL 值的列应用 NOT NULL 约束时会发生什么?

示例假设我们有一个表“test2”,其中第2行的“ID”列中包含NULL值。现在,如果我们尝试将列ID声明为NOTNULL,那么MySQL将返回错误,如下所示-mysql>Select*fromtest2;+------+--------+|ID|Name|...

MySQL返回结果集的行中如何过滤掉重复的行?

示例我们有已应用的表“Student”DISTINCT关键字如下-mysql>Select*fromstudent;+------+---------+---------+-----------+|Id|Name|Address|Subject|+------+---------+---------+------...

使用 MySQLi 相对于 MySQL 有何优势?

MySQLiisalsoknownasMySQLimprovedExtension.ItisarelationalSQLdatabasemanagementsystem.ItisoftenusedinsidePHPtoprovideaninterfacewiththeMySQLdatabases.MySQLi之所以著名的一...

我们如何通过从另一个现有表中选择特定列来创建新的 MySQL 表?

众所周知,我们可以通过CTAS脚本从现有表中复制数据和结构。如果我们想从另一个表中选择一些特定的列,那么我们需要在SELECT之后提及它们。考虑以下示例,其中我们通过从现有表“Employee”中选择特定列“name”来创建...

如何在MySQL中将DATETIME中的日期和时间分开?

要从DATETIME中分离出DATE和TIME,您可以使用MySQL的DATE_FORMAT()方法。语法如下−SELECTDATE_FORMAT(yourColumnName,'%Y-%m-%d')VariableName,DATE_FORMAT(yourColumnName,'%H:%i:%s')Va...

如何停止运行 MySQL 查询?

在停止MySQL的运行查询之前,我们首先需要看到有多少个进程。使用show命令运行。查询如下所示−mysql>showprocesslist;Afterexecutingtheabovequery,wewillgettheoutputwithsomeid’s.This...

如何对NUMC类型字段使用SUM函数?

以上就是如何对NUMC类型字段使用SUM函数?的详细内容,更多请关注其它相关文章!...

如果会话在事务中途结束,当前 MySQL 事务会发生什么情况?

示例假设我们在表“marks”中有以下值mysql>Select*frommarks;+------+---------+-----------+-------+|Id|Name|Subject|Marks|+------+---------+-----------+-------+|1|Aarav|M...

为什么我在将“1965-05-15”等日期转换为 TIMESTAMP 时得到输出 0(零)?

众所周知,借助MySQLUNIX_TIMESTAMP函数,我们可以生成给定日期/日期时间的秒数。但是,当我们尝试转换像“1965-05-15”这样的日期时,它会给出0(零)作为输出,因为TIMESTAMP的范围在“1970-01-0100:00:01”到“2038-01-...

MySQL ENUM 值如何排序?

MySQL还可以存储空的字符串和空值转换为ENUM。它将空字符串排序在非空字符串之前,将NULL排序在空字符串之前。因此排序顺序如下-<tr>ENUM值的排序顺序  1.NULL  2.空字符串<tdstyle="width:100%;tex...

哪个 MySQL 函数返回指定数量的字符串作为输出?

MySQL借助LEFT()和RIGHT()函数返回字符串中指定数量的字符。MySQLLEFT()函数将从字符串左侧返回指定数量的字符字符串。语法LEFT(str,length)这里str是要返回多个字符的字符串,长度是一个整数值,指定要返回的...